WNBA’s Expansion to the Bay Area: Here’s What You Need to Know!

Exciting news for WNBA fans as the league has announced it will add a 13th team in the Bay Area, with the Golden State Warriors as the proud owners. And if that wasn’t enough, there are rumors of a second expansion franchise, likely Portland, that could begin play in 2025. The league’s commissioner, Cathy Engelbert, has revealed the goal is to have 14 teams by 2025.

The new team, which is expected to be called “Golden State,” has already caused a stir in the basketball world. Playing home games at the state-of-the-art Chase Center in San Francisco and practicing in Oakland, the team is set to make waves as it brings women’s basketball back to a market that has seen WNBA action in the past.

What’s more, the Golden State Warriors have reportedly paid a “record-breaking” expansion fee for the league, signaling significant investments in the team that have left fans and analysts buzzing.

Why is the WNBA expanding now?

It seems the time is right for expansion, with the rising interest in women’s basketball evident in the increased viewership, attendance, merchandise sales, and sponsorship interest over the past decade. As Joe Lacob, the Golden State Warriors’ co-executive chairman and CEO, stated, “The league is ready,” reflecting the growing enthusiasm for the women’s game.

The expansion team is expected to be built through an expansion draft, likely to be held in late 2024. This process will surely bring about a new wave of talent and excitement as the league continues its positive trajectory.

Why is the Bay Area a good fit, and what could set this Golden State team apart?

Beyond providing a new market for the WNBA, the Bay Area’s status as a “tech center” with a robust economy makes it a logical destination for the expansion. Commissioner Engelbert explained that the region’s strong demographics and its position as a major media market will contribute to the success of the new team.

Furthermore, the Warriors’ ownership brings a wealth of expertise and a demonstrated commitment to women’s basketball. With the Golden State team set to play in top-tier facilities and under the leadership of the seasoned Warriors organization, it’s clear that there’s great promise ahead for the new expansion team.
